Engraved by William Miller after the painting by S. Williamson. A superb high quality antique engraving with an extraordinary amount of detail. Reverse side blank. This fine engraving shows a ship which is about to be crushed against the cliffs and is a fine piece for framing. There are some slight toning at the edges.
Image size approx. 4-3/4" x 3"
Paper size - 10-1/2" x 8-1/4"
Printed 1866
